Workers cannot fetch queue credentials; all job processing is paused. No evidence of compromise — seal was triggered by the rotation threshold policy. Requesting approval to unseal and resume migration. Audit log excerpt attached to this ticket. Unseal requires the standing recovery passphrase, which is recorded immediately below for the approved operator.

unlock words, yawig-kagef: gordor-holvan-ulaael-pramir-ulaiel-tamdor

### Account Recovery — Catalogue Import (Lintwood)

Quick one for review: when the Lintwood catalogue import wipes a patron's session table, the recovery flow re-seeds accounts from the nightly snapshot. Check that the importer skips locked accounts — last time it didn't. To rerun recovery against staging you'll need the vault passphrase, which is appended just below.

recovery phrase for yafof-tajof: julmir-kelax-julvan-holath-belvan-holir-ralael-ralvan-ralath-julvan-silmir-istmir-kaswyn-ulamir

# Larkspur Environments — Canary Gating

Quick primer for plugin folks: Larkspur promotes builds through dev, canary, and prod. Canary traffic is held at a small slice until error-rate and latency gates pass for two consecutive windows. Your plugin gets the same treatment, no exceptions. The gating rules currently in effect are configured as follows.

service settings:
PRAIX_LOG_LEVEL=error
PRAIX_METRICS_HOST=metrics.praix.qorvelcorp.corp
PRAIX_POOL_SIZE=16

## Changelog — Telemetry defaults (Skylark Collector v4.2)

Heads up for the sync: we flipped the default telemetry compression from gzip to zstd-3 after Priya's bake-off on the Tarnwick staging fleet. Payloads shrank ~38% and CPU overhead stayed flat, so uncompressed submission is now opt-in only. Plugins built against the old framing still work — the collector sniffs the magic bytes. If your dashboards show a dip in ingress bytes, that's expected, not data loss. The defaults now in effect are as follows.

service settings:
HOLMIR_PIN=4823
HOLMIR_METRICS_HOST=metrics.holmir.nelvroworks.internal
HOLMIR_LOG_LEVEL=info
HOLMIR_TENANT=istael